Голосование

Каким загрузчиком чаще пользуетесь?

Grub
lilo
Boot
NTLDR
OS/2
RedBoot
SILO
Loadlin
Syslinux
BOOTP
Yaboot
BootX
bootman
BootManager
Das U-Boot
Plop Boot Manager
SyMon
Acronis os selector
uMon

Автор Тема: LILO, grub, (initrd, MBR)) Правка, rescue загрузчиков . Общие вопросы.  (Прочитано 163295 раз)

Оффлайн dsh

  • Участник
  • *
  • Сообщений: 167
Re: Две ОС Линукс
« Ответ #750 : 19.05.2009 00:15:16 »
Я делал так:
В /boot/grub/menu.lst добавить:
title ALT Linux 5.0
root (hd0,...)
kernel /boot/vmlinuz root=UUID=...
initrd /boot/initrd.img

UUID можно узнать дав в консоли команду:
sudo blkid
затем:
sudo update-grub
Если использовать для загрузки LILO, то нельзя будет попробовать фичу U9.04 - ext4

Оффлайн Const

  • Глобальный модератор
  • *****
  • Сообщений: 2 653
  • Даже у плохого модератора есть свои плюсы…
Re: Две ОС Линукс
« Ответ #751 : 19.05.2009 06:58:28 »
Второй вариант: загрузчик Убунты ставить в её раздел, затем грузиться в ALT, монтировать куда-то раздел с убунтовским /boot, править /etc/lilo.conf и вызывать lilo.

В этом меню загрузки будет от ALT ;)

Оффлайн moby

  • Участник
  • *
  • Сообщений: 58
    • Вышивка на заказ
Re: Две ОС Линукс
« Ответ #752 : 19.05.2009 21:14:03 »
Я делал так:
В /boot/grub/menu.lst добавить:
title ALT Linux 5.0
root (hd0,...)
kernel /boot/vmlinuz root=UUID=...
initrd /boot/initrd.img

UUID можно узнать дав в консоли команду:
sudo blkid
затем:
sudo update-grub
Если использовать для загрузки LILO, то нельзя будет попробовать фичу U9.04 - ext4
Ну фичу с ext4 еще както нехочу пробовать, товарищ говорил что неочень хотя незнаю... меня и ext3 устраивает :)
За подсказки всем спасибо.

Оффлайн allen

  • Участник
  • *
  • Сообщений: 25
Lilo - device not found
« Ответ #753 : 21.05.2009 15:17:05 »
При загрузке lilo ругается - device not found, use normal boot на
append="resume=/dev/disk/by-uuid/e8fe31c9-a2fa-4550-915c-8926783c4773 panic=30 splash=silent" из lilo.conf и загружается далее нормально
Lilo в mbr
Какой uuid нужен lilo для этого append ?

Оффлайн moby

  • Участник
  • *
  • Сообщений: 58
    • Вышивка на заказ
Re: Две ОС Линукс
« Ответ #754 : 22.05.2009 23:04:27 »
Еще вопросик к этой теме - поставил убунту в грабе добавил альт все грузится, но в альте я не могу просмотреть информацию которая размещена на разделе где стоит убунту, выдает вот такое сообщение:
 Произошла ошыбка при обращении к Volume (ext3), ответ системы:
org.freedesktop.Hal.Device.PermissionDeniedByPolicy:
org.freedesktop.hal.storage.mount-fixed auth_admin_keep_always <--
(action, result)

Подскажите как с этим справится. Кстати первый пример который подсказал (Сом) не подошел так-как выдавало ошибку, а вот с примером (dsh) все норм :)
Заранее всем благодарен за ответы! 

Оффлайн Const

  • Глобальный модератор
  • *****
  • Сообщений: 2 653
  • Даже у плохого модератора есть свои плюсы…
Re: Две ОС Линукс
« Ответ #755 : 22.05.2009 23:09:46 »
это нормально: кде4 не умеет туда обращаться, если недостаточно прав.
Лучше всего либо монтировать руками от рута, либо аккуратно в /etc/fstab прописать с параметром user

Оффлайн moby

  • Участник
  • *
  • Сообщений: 58
    • Вышивка на заказ
Re: Две ОС Линукс
« Ответ #756 : 22.05.2009 23:24:37 »
это нормально: кде4 не умеет туда обращаться, если недостаточно прав.
Лучше всего либо монтировать руками от рута, либо аккуратно в /etc/fstab прописать с параметром user
А можете пример написать как это сделать? Ссори я еще в этом деле валенок :)

Оффлайн dsh

  • Участник
  • *
  • Сообщений: 167
Re: Две ОС Линукс
« Ответ #757 : 22.05.2009 23:39:44 »
/dev/... /mnt/... ext3 ro, auto, user  0 0

Оффлайн moby

  • Участник
  • *
  • Сообщений: 58
    • Вышивка на заказ
Re: Две ОС Линукс
« Ответ #758 : 23.05.2009 00:05:41 »
/dev/... /mnt/... ext3 ro, auto, user  0 0
подскажыте это в fstab нужно прописать?

Оффлайн dsh

  • Участник
  • *
  • Сообщений: 167
Re: Две ОС Линукс
« Ответ #759 : 23.05.2009 00:15:48 »
Цитировать
подскажыте это в fstab нужно прописать?
Да.
/dev/... - Диск который будем монтировать. (посмотреть - fdisk -l от рута)
/mnt/... - Каталог куда будем монтировать (нужно предварительно создать)
auto - монтировать автоматически
user - от пользователя
ro - только чтение

Оффлайн moby

  • Участник
  • *
  • Сообщений: 58
    • Вышивка на заказ
Re: Две ОС Линукс
« Ответ #760 : 23.05.2009 19:38:25 »
Цитировать
подскажыте это в fstab нужно прописать?
Да.
/dev/... - Диск который будем монтировать. (посмотреть - fdisk -l от рута)
/mnt/... - Каталог куда будем монтировать (нужно предварительно создать)
auto - монтировать автоматически
user - от пользователя
ro - только чтение

Нужна еще ваша помощь. Значит с просмотром и записью в разделе убунту я разобрался, там просто нужно было поменять UUID, в fstab был написан другой код. UUID нашел с помощью команды:
ls -l /dev/disk/by-uuid/ так как при вводе команды (blkid) в консоли выдавало (команда не найдена).
Я с помощью (акрониса) удалил и заново создал раздел С: NTFS, на данный момент он чистый - альт его видит но я также немогу его просмотреть или записать какую либо информацию. 
Вот так на данный момент выглядит строка в Fstab:
UUID=EC714E4F8AFF9C79  /mnt/sda1       ntfs-3g locale=ru_RU,UTF-8,dmask=0,fmask=0111 0 0
      команда mount -a выдает:
 [mntent]: строка 12 в /etc/fstab плохая
 ntfs-3g: Failed to access volume 'UUID=EC714E4F8AFF9C79': Нет такого файла или каталога
 Please type '/sbin/mount.ntfs-3g --help' for more information.
     Подскажите  что нужно сделать, чтобы можно было работать с этим разделом.
И плюс к этому всему если я установлю на диск С Windows, я так понял винда затрет граб, что мне нужно будит сделать чтобы после установки виндовс остался загрузчик граб?

Оффлайн Const

  • Глобальный модератор
  • *****
  • Сообщений: 2 653
  • Даже у плохого модератора есть свои плюсы…
Re: Две ОС Линукс
« Ответ #761 : 23.05.2009 19:45:13 »
А что вам непонятно? внятно же сказано: нет раздела с указанным UUID

Оффлайн moby

  • Участник
  • *
  • Сообщений: 58
    • Вышивка на заказ
Re: Две ОС Линукс
« Ответ #762 : 23.05.2009 19:52:12 »
А что вам непонятно? внятно же сказано: нет раздела с указанным UUID
да я понял что там написано, но раздел смонтирован альт его видит - вопрос как мне правильно прописать его в fstab? чтобы с ним работать

Оффлайн dsh

  • Участник
  • *
  • Сообщений: 167
Re: Две ОС Линукс
« Ответ #763 : 23.05.2009 20:10:09 »
Цитировать
да я понял что там написано
Ну тогда исправьте UUID

Оффлайн moby

  • Участник
  • *
  • Сообщений: 58
    • Вышивка на заказ
Re: Две ОС Линукс
« Ответ #764 : 23.05.2009 20:54:06 »
ну все нашел я выход из этой ситуации - решылось очень просто вместо старой строчки:
UUID=EC714E4F8AFF9C79  /mnt/sda1       ntfs-3g locale=ru_RU,UTF-8,dmask=0,fmask=0111 0 0
нужно было написать:
/dev/sda1  /mnt/sda1       ntfs-3g locale=ru_RU,UTF-8,dmask=0,fmask=0111 0 0